What this role is
This role oversees aircraft maintenance and preparation work performed by external vendors, requiring the manager to coordinate across Allegiant Air departments and maintenance providers while ensuring regulatory compliance. The position suits experienced aviation maintenance professionals with supervisory background and deep knowledge of A320 and 737 aircraft operations.

What they ask for
Required
- High school diploma or GED
- Airframe and Powerplant (A&P) license
- Minimum 6 years working on A320 and 737 aircraft
- Minimum 5 years managing direct reports or working independently
- Minimum 10 years heavy maintenance experience on Part 121 transport aircraft
- Valid unexpired passport
- Valid unexpired driver's license
- A320 general familiarization course or Airbus A320 training
- Authorized to work in the US
- Pass criminal background check
Nice to have
- Associate's degree or higher
- Recent certificate privileges exercise or FAA approval
